Toga-Lock


Im an expat thats been in the company since 2011.. before your hear the doom and gloom from a "Professional Rumour" forum let me say Yes absolutely there been and still present really frustrating challenging moments working within the environmental dynamics of THY but to give them credit there are more moments when you feel relaxed and at eased just enjoying what life has to offer you as you see improvements occur.. ... its totally dependent on your mind set...
without getting in to a philosophical essay and conflict of views with other members here about the dynamics of THY .. ill give you my experience and view of THY from my eyes.

firstly the PAY
few months ago the TRY was on a free fall base jump and as a result lost nearly half its value which effected us expats as our salaries are paid in the local currency with not set exchange rate safety net.. this prompted THY management of increase pay of flight crew in order to keep the them from going else where .. did it work ?? may be maybe not.. i haven't got any management responsibilities so really dont look at that aspect..... hence i look at it from perspective and yes it help somewhat hence i am still here.

last few months we have seen 30% followed by a 20% increase respectively so at the moment the flight pay without the 70hrs overtime benefit flight, duties on a Sunday, public holidays, per-diems (qrtly bonus of one base salary is factored in)

Wide Body Captains: Approx. 70,000 TL
Narrow Body Captains: Approx. 59,000 TL
First Officers: Approx. 33,000 TL
taxes to be paid are at a rate of approx 4% and the company deducts this from your paycheck..
another salary rise is to be given at the end of year due to the inflation differences ( as per the collective bargaining agreement) not sure what this value is ..

as per ROSTER ..
Interesting things started to happen a few months ago when THY did a clean sweep of Flight ops Management and replaced all from vice president of flight OPs down to the all the fleet managers.. and more importantly crew planning was once again moved under the control of flight operations!!! which was insanity in the first place putting under another department. anyway there are improvements slow trickling down ... slowly .... but at least its a improving trend!!!!

now for the Wide body... definitely you can commute, especially if your on the B777.. man these guys have probably the best roster and conditions out there if you dont consider pay as the number 1 priority ... but then again for the condition they have .. i would certainty have a smile from ear to ear.. (mostly long haul avg. 3-4 flights per month excluding any domestic sector if any)

Airbus captain have more euro flights when compared to the B777 fleet are a bit more busy and as i said all wide body captain get the 3week on 1week off so commuting is definitely possible.

what HR would tell you is its a commuting contract, which means 3 weeks on 1 week off excluding travel time. In addition, all wide body Captains receive one ID100 confirmed ticket per month to use at the start and end of the block off days and All expat captains get 2 ID90 tickets per month ( Wife and children up to 25yo also get 2 ID90 ticketds per month each).

Narrow body (B737 and A320) .... Expat captains get only the ID90 benefits stated above ... commuting can be challenging but not an impossibility.. you get 6 block days off per month.. but there are some funky things happening in Crew Planing .. the director of crew planning is also a B737 Captain and improvements are in the pipeline especially for the narrow body ( in particular the B737) (I.e some rumors that annual leave might be garnished and added to block days per month .. rumor only no
official notice or info as yet.)

Abu Dhabi event
the latest i been told is that it will only be a roadshow with no interviews or assessments..

hope this helps...

Kapitanleutnant 13th Dec 2018 00:12

Alfa... from last year, you'll usually have two or three days off between your Long Haul trips and I knew some guys would commute up to Europe during those days...depnding on arrival times of the last trip vs start times of the next trip. There was some time restriction about being in IST "X" number of hours prior to check in.

Also... As I'm reading the information, the wide body pay left seat is 70,000 Turkish Lira which at todays rate is: $13,000 but just remember you have to factor out the bonus which is only every 3 months, so maybe 12K per month which is not bad IMO.

Kap
